Computing Facility of the Institute of Computational Technologies SB RAS.- HPC in Industrial Environments.- Parallel Realization of Mathematical Modelling of Electromagnetic Logging Processes Using VIKIZ Probe Complex.- Numerical Solution of Some Direct and Inverse Mathematical Problems for Tidal Flows.- Hardware Development and Impact on Numerical Algorithms.- Mathematical Modeling in Application to Regional Tsunami Warning Systems Operations.- Parallel and Adaptive Simulation of Fuel Cells in 3d.- Numerical Modeling of Some Free Turbulent Flows.- Mathematical and Numerical Modelling of Fluid Flow in Elastic Tubes.- Parallel Numerical Modeling of Modern Fibre Optics Devices.- Zonal Large-Eddy Simulations and Aeroacoustics of High-Lift Airfoil Configurations.- Experimental Statistical Attacks on Block and Stream Ciphers.- On Performance and Accuracy of Lattice Boltzmann Approaches for Single Phase Flow in Porous Media: A Toy Became an Accepted Tool — How to Maintain Its Features Despite More and More Complex (Physical) Models and Changing Trends in High Performance Computing!?.- Parameter Partition Methods for Optimal Numerical Solution of Interval Linear Systems.- Comparative Analysis of the SPH and ISPH Methods.- SEGL: A Problem Solving Environment for the Design and Execution of Complex Scientific Grid Applications.- A Service-Oriented Architecture for Some Problems of Municipal Management (Example of the City of Irkutsk Municipal Administration).- Basic Tendencies of the Telemedicine Technologies Development in Siberian Region.
